STRAIGHT OUTTA STOCKHOLM (PT 1) when I made the pilgrimage to Sweden, it was to make music at the Mecca of pop music. I wanted to breathe the air and drink the water that fueled Max Martin. I needed to visit the old Cheiron studios and walk the same sidewalks that Britney, NSYNC, and Backstreet Boys walked. I had to get as far away from home and my comfort zone as possible to write and produce new music. “How Far Will You Go” is one of two songs I recorded in Stockholm. I produced this in ableton on trains in Paris,Brussels, Amsterdam, and Hamburg. (Hearing the track puts me on the move across Europe all over again.) The night before the session in Sweden, I had been working so hard on the other song I made (!! which I’ll share soon) that I realized I forgot to write how far will you go. So I wrote the song and tracked a scratch vocal half asleep, hoping for the best the next day. Huge thank you to Christopher Göthberg and Sonika Studio for having me. One day I hope to record an entire album here.
